The truth unfolds

Kai stumbled through the door of his home, his heart still racing from his encounter with the bakery owner. He could feel the lingering sensation of Vallentino's touch on his wrist, the warmth of the kiss still imprinted on his lips. The more he thought about it, the more he couldn’t shake the feeling that he was being pulled toward something—or someone—he didn’t fully understand.

He closed the door behind him with a soft click, leaning against it for support. His breath was shaky, his mind spinning with confusion.

"You're home late," his mother’s voice called from the kitchen, where the smell of dinner wafted through the air.

Kai didn’t answer immediately, still lost in his thoughts. How could someone have such a familiar presence? How did that bakery owner know him from the ice cream shop, a job he’d left behind months ago?

"Everything okay?" His mother’s voice was filled with concern now as she walked toward him, noticing the confusion in his eyes.

Kai ran a hand through his hair, still unsettled by the memory of the kiss and Vallentino’s words. "Yeah, I’m fine... I think." His voice faltered.

His mother raised an eyebrow, crossing her arms. "What’s going on, Kai? You’ve been acting strange ever since you came home."

Kai shook his head, still processing everything. "I don’t know. I just... met someone. Someone who feels like they know me. It’s like... I’ve seen them before, but I don’t know when. It’s weird."

His mother frowned, clearly concerned. "Who is it? Maybe you’re just overthinking things. You’ve had a lot of change recently. A lot to process."

Kai sighed, walking over to the couch and sinking down into it. "I met the bakery owner today. His name is Vallentino. But... he looked at me like he knew me. And then he kissed me." Kai’s voice trembled as he spoke. "I don’t know what’s going on, Mom. It doesn’t make sense."

His mother sat down beside him, placing a comforting hand on his shoulder. "Kai, it’s okay. You’re probably just feeling overwhelmed. You’ve been through a lot, and sometimes, things that don’t make sense can feel really intense. Maybe you should take a step back and think things through before reacting."

Kai nodded slowly, but he couldn’t shake the image of Vallentino’s face from his mind. There was something in his eyes—something that pulled at his heart in a way that he couldn’t explain.

"I just... I can’t stop thinking about him," Kai admitted, his voice barely above a whisper.

His mother gave him a reassuring smile, but there was a glint of something else in her eyes, something Kai couldn’t quite place. "You’ll figure it out, Kai. Just take things one step at a time. And remember, you’re not alone."

Kai glanced up at her, his eyes filled with uncertainty. "But what if I can’t figure it out? What if there’s more to this than I realize?"

His mother gave his shoulder a gentle squeeze. "Then we’ll figure it out together. Don’t worry."

Kai nodded again, though a lingering sense of unease settled in his chest. Something told him that the encounter with Vallentino wasn’t just a random event—it was part of something much bigger. And he wasn’t sure if he was ready to face whatever that might be.

As the evening passed, Kai couldn’t shake the thoughts of Vallentino from his mind. He kept replaying their meeting, wondering if he had missed something important. Could this mysterious bakery owner really be someone from his past? Or was it just a strange coincidence?

Eventually, he drifted off to sleep, his dreams filled with flashes of golden-blue eyes and the warm touch of a kiss. But even in sleep, the questions lingered.
